Tell the full story of India's heroes.
2 answers
2024-11-01 11:01
India has many heroes. Mahatma Gandhi is one of the most prominent. He led the non - violent resistance against British rule. Through peaceful marches, boycotts, and civil disobedience, he fought for India's independence. His philosophy of non - violence inspired many around the world. Another hero could be Subhas Chandra Bose, who was more militant in his approach. He formed the Indian National Army and tried to liberate India from the British with military means. There were also countless unnamed heroes who fought at the grassroots level, in villages and towns, for basic rights and freedom.

What are the main events in the full story of India's heroes?
2 answers
2024-11-02 20:29
For Gandhi, the main event was the Salt March in 1930. It was a 240 - mile march to the Arabian Sea to protest against the British salt monopoly. This simple act of civil disobedience was a turning point in India's struggle for independence.
